Understanding Intimacy

Before diving into practical tips, it is crucial to understand the different forms of intimacy:

  1. Emotional Intimacy: The ability to share feelings, thoughts, and experiences openly with a partner.

  2. Physical Intimacy: This includes sexual contact but also embraces forms of physical closeness such as cuddling and holding hands.

  3. Intellectual Intimacy: Sharing ideas, thoughts, and values fosters a deeper connection.

  4. Experiential Intimacy: Sharing experiences, whether through travel, hobbies, or shared activities.

According to Dr. Sue Johnson, a renowned psychologist and the developer of Emotionally Focused Therapy (EFT), “The more emotionally connected partners feel, the more satisfying and intimate their sexual experiences become.” Therefore, focusing on enhancing all these types of intimacy can lead to more fulfilling sexual experiences.

Practical Tips to Enhance Intimacy and Connection

1. Foster Open Communication

Effective communication is the cornerstone of intimacy. Engaging in open dialogues about desires, fantasies, and boundaries can significantly improve sexual satisfaction. Here are some actionable steps:

  • Set Aside Time: Create a safe space for discussions by setting aside time, free from distractions.
  • Active Listening: Make an effort to listen actively. Repeat back what your partner says to confirm understanding.
  • Use “I” Statements: Approach conversations using “I” statements to express how you feel without sounding accusatory. For instance, say “I feel closer when we share our fantasies” instead of “You never tell me what you want.”

Expert Insight: According to Dr. Laura Berman, a well-known sex therapist, "Communication is key. Many couples shy away from discussing their sexual desires, leading to frustration and a lack of intimacy."

2. Explore Each Other’s Bodies

Physical intimacy can be enhanced through exploration. Here’s how to make this exploration more engaging:

  • Take Your Time: Don’t rush into intercourse. Spend time understanding each other’s bodies through foreplay.
  • Engage All Senses: Use your hands, mouths, and even eyes. Light touch, gentle kisses, and prolonged eye contact can spark deeper connections.
  • Introduce Novelty: Try different techniques or settings that excite you both. This could mean experimenting with temperature (using ice cubes or warm oil) or various positions.

Example: Consider having a sensual massage session, where both partners take turns exploring each other’s bodies. This can serve to build anticipation and deepen connection.

5. Practice Mindfulness Together

Mindfulness can enhance awareness and connection during intimate moments. Here are some methods:

  • Meditation: Spend a few minutes meditating together before getting intimate. It helps reduce anxiety and enhance focus on the present moment.
  • Breath Work: Synchronizing breath can heighten intimacy. Spend a few moments breathing together to create a shared rhythm.
  • Body Scan: Spend time exploring your body mentally, focusing on sensations as you connect with your partner.
